Meeting of the CA of the Mohammed VI Foundation for the Promotion of Social Works of Education-Training

The Steering Committee of the Mohammed VI Foundation for the Promotion of Social Works of Education-Training held, on Thursday, January 26, 2023 in Rabat, a session devoted to the presentation of the Foundation’s activity report for the year 2022 and to the approval of the projects and the provisional budget for the year 2023.

In the field of health, the Foundation is making great strides to create structures and care equipment dedicated to the teaching family. The mobile medical units have been acquired and are being equipped. As for hospital center projects, technical and architectural studies have been undertaken for the construction of two hospitals, one in Agadir and the other in Oujda.

Pending the materialization of these major projects, the members of the Foundation and their families benefit from a social welfare system complementary to that of the AMO. In 2022, more than 155,000 families had access to complementary health insurance, and to medical assistance and transport. The Foundation has disbursed more than 200 million dirhams to provide these two services during the past year.

On the housing side, the Foundation has allocated 1.7 billion dirhams for the subsidy of real estate financing acquired by its members since the launch of the IMTILAK program in September 2019 until the end of 2022; which has enabled more than 29,000 people to acquire their main home.

During this year, the Foundation set up a new financing aid mechanism “Yassir”; consisting of the total or partial subsidy of social loans. This new service recorded more than 27,000 beneficiaries, 92.8% of whom opted for the loan of 20,000 DH at an interest rate of 0%.

In terms of support for the financing of studies, the Foundation granted the children of members 2,110 ISTIHQAQ scholarships for an annual cost of 66 million dirhams. and more than 26,000 preschool subsidies at a cost of more than 52 million dirhams for 2022.

And to strengthen the access of its members and their families to information technologies, the Nafida 2 program has enabled nearly 30,000 people to acquire a computer between June 2021 and December 2022. As for the reduction on Internet subscriptions, more than 57,000 people have benefited from it for an estimated value of more than 6 million dirhams per month.

The Foundation has also increased the subsidy applied to public fares for rail and road transport. The reduction on travel by train (Al Boraq, TGL, TNR) has increased from 30 at 40% ; while that applied to travel via Supratours coaches has gone from 25 at 40%.

In 2023, the Foundation will continue to implement its 2018-2028 strategic action plan by accelerating in particular:

  • construction of health centers;
  • the commissioning of mobile medical units;
  • the completion and construction of new cultural centers;
  • the construction and development of new tourist complexes …

At the end of the session, the members of the Committee expressed their satisfaction with the achievements presented and unanimously approved the draft budget for the year 2023.
